    TDP stands for Thermal Design Power and is used to measure the amount of heat a component is expected to output when under load. For example, a CPU may have a TDP of 90W and therefore is expected to output 90W worth of heat when in use.
    CPU TDP, or Thermal Design Power, is a term that describes the maximum amount of heat generated by a CPU under normal operating conditions. It is an essential characteristic of a processor that provides valuable information for system builders, overclockers, and anyone looking to optimize the performance and longevity of their CPU.
    TDP stands for Thermal Design Power, which is the maximum amount of heat a CPU is expected to generate under typical workloads. It is measured in watts and indicates the amount of cooling required to keep the CPU operating within its temperature limits.

    So, a CPU’s TDP is meant to correspond to the power requirements of a CPU as it performs out-of-box. It isn’t solely a cooling concern: it’s what the manufacturer is calling the maximum power limit before Turbo frequency or overclocking is applied.

    While power consumption refers to the actual electrical power consumed by a CPU, TDP represents the maximum amount of heat that the CPU will generate. However, TDP and power consumption are interrelated, as a higher TDP often translates to higher power consumption. So why is CPU TDP important?
